Moving rootvg disks to another system sometimes works if *ALL* of the
required drivers are present (disk, scsi, ...). You will need to boot
from SMS since the boot list has the PVIDs stored in nvram on the system
board.
Once the system is booted use the bootlist command to update the boot
list in nvram.
You may need to boot into maintenance mode and start a shell, to run the
bootlist command.

The procedure goes on to say that if removing the memory modules doesn't
help you should move on to the system board and other components.
Taking a disk from one system and using it to boot another can work, but
isn't always simple. It should be OK with PCI hardware but expect to
have
to change a few things and at the least run cfgmgr with the install CD
loaded.
I've only done it with an MCA SP2 node and that was a lot of trouble,
(but
better than the alternative at the time, since I had some critical data
that
wasn't backed up). I'm told PCI servers are much easier, and of course
the
PSSP configuration added to my woes.

Thanks Simon. This is the procedure I had the FE follow but it did not
correct the problem. There were only 2 simms in the system. They are
going
to take another system to the site and try swapping in the new memory
from
the new system. This system had only two disks for the rootvg mirrored.
Can I take the disk from the old system and put them in the new system
and
boot it up? Is there some steps I need to do to make this work?

The 43P Service Guide is the only source of information on this. It
basically describes removing the memory modules in order to find the
faulty
one.
There's no quick and easy way: you'll have to be methodical and you'll
end
up booting the system lots of times, potentially.
In my copy of the manual, it's MAP1240 on page 2-12. Don't skimp on the
steps, or try to take shortcuts.
